I travel quite a bit on planes and always carry my iPad Mini with me, this product is fantastic! It allows you to keep your hands free and elevates the iPad to a comfortable viewing position, and eliminates the need to put your tray table down cramping your leg space or allows you to use the tray for work while watching a movie. It attaches easily to the airline tray and is adjustable unlike other holders so it is very easy to adjust the angle when the person in front of you reclines their seat. A tip: If it is a little loose there is a spacer that is provided and I found putting the hanger clip near the tray latch gives it a little more stability if the fit is loose. I contacted the seller who was happy to supply an additional spacer. This product is very small and easy to carry; I keep mine in an old fabric sunglass bag in my carryon. I have had several people in nearby seats bent over their iPads and flight attendants ask where i got it. Another tip: Removing the sleep cover on your iPad case will allow for your iPad to sit a little further back in the clip and make it less likely jiggle loose during severe turbulence. I love travel gadgets and this is definitely one of my new favorites...nice to be able to fall asleep on long flights without worrying that my iPad will hit the floor when my grip loosens. Great product, I've been looking for something like this for a long time so that my neck wouldn't hurt looking down and my arm wouldn't get tired holding the phone up. I use it with a Samsung Galaxy S7 Edge with no problems.A few things that could make it even better:1. It would be great if the metal piece connecting the holder to the tray table could twist. I actually removed the screw, turned the piece around, and put the screw back in, this puts the phone a few more inches higher as I'm trying to get it eye-level. (See 4th picture)2. Put a some rubber around the edges so that when you're using it as a stand it doesn't slide around. Sitting on the train it moved quite a bit unless I was holding it down. (See 3rd picture)3. Somehow be able to attach the plastic piece for the smaller tray tables to the holder so that it doesn't get lost while not in use. It looks like there's a place for it but it doesn't stay there. (See 1st and 5th picture)The only thing I didn't like was that the screw looks like it has some surface rust and doesn't look as high quality as the rest of it. (See last picture)
